Zach Prince steps down as United head coach and technical director

"It wasn't a simple decision, because how special this place is."

New Mexico United is making a coaching change.Zach Prince stepped down as head coach and technical director moments after the United's 1-0 loss to El Paso on Saturday. He leaves the organization 11 games into his second season to pursue an unannounced opportunity.Prince led New Mexico to a playoff berth in 2022. Under his guidance, United earned the most points, goals scored and highest goal differential in team history.Owner Peter Trevisani praised Prince in a statement, saying "Zach is a living example of the mantra 'Hard work and action pay off.' He led our team to the postseason and has created a foundation upon which we will build."Trevisani said the team expects to make an announcement by Monday, regarding the direction of the team moving forward.
